This is an auction for COLLECTING HIMSELF: ON WRITING AND WRITERS, HUMOUR AND HIMSELF, by James Thurber.
"This is a heady mix: laser-sharp criticism of shoddy, pretentious plays and novels balanced by insightful praise of worthy ones; comments, more in anger than in sorrow, on New Yorker founder Harold Ross and others whom Thurber considered to be over-zealous editors; essays on humour, etc. The anthology includes an abundance of reprinted material but also pieces not previously published - every entry is a reminder of Thurber's sublime wit." - Publishers Weekly (US)
"In this collection, what is revealed is a glimpse of Thurber the man, the philosopher, and the critic. A number of the pieces are excerpts from his many interviews and commentaries, spanning 30 years. In these he shares with the reader his coping with progressive blindness, his method of drawing, his writing tactics, and his personal relationships. His critical views on theatre, other writers, and the state of humour itself are also divulged." - Library Journal (US)

"James Grover Thurber (1894–1961) was an American cartoonist, writer, humourist, journalist and playwright, best known for his cartoons and short stories, published mainly in The New Yorker. Thurber celebrated the comic frustrations and eccentricities of ordinary people. His best-known short stories are "The Dog That Bit People", "The Night the Bed Fell", "The Secret Life of Walter Mitty", "The Catbird Seat", "The Night the Ghost Got In", "A Couple of Hamburgers", "The Greatest Man in the World", and "If Grant Had Been Drinking at Appomattox"..."
